Tabel RemoveIniFile
Tabel RemoveIniFile berisi informasi yang perlu dihapus aplikasi dari file .ini.
Tabel RemoveIniFile memiliki kolom berikut.
Kolom | Jenis | Kunci | Dapat diubah ke null |
---|---|---|---|
RemoveIniFile | Pengidentifikasi | Y | N |
Filename | FileName | N | N |
DirProperty | Pengidentifikasi | N | Y |
Bagian | Diformat | N | N |
Kunci | Diformat | N | N |
Nilai | Diformat | N | Y |
Perbuatan | Bilangan Bulat | N | N |
Komponen_ | Pengidentifikasi | N | N |
Kolom
-
RemoveIniFile
-
Kunci untuk tabel ini.
-
FileName
-
Nama file .ini untuk menghapus informasi.
-
DirProperty
-
Nama properti yang nilainya diasumsikan untuk diselesaikan ke jalur lengkap ke folder file .ini yang akan dihapus. Properti dapat menjadi nama direktori dalam tabel Direktori , properti yang ditetapkan oleh tabel AppSearch, atau properti lain yang mewakili jalur lengkap.
-
Bagian
-
Bagian file .ini yang dapat dilokalkan.
-
Kunci
-
Kunci file .ini yang dapat dilokalkan di bawah bagian .
-
Nilai
-
Nilai yang dapat dilokalkan untuk dihapus. Nilai diperlukan saat Tindakan adalah 4.
-
Tindakan
-
Jenis modifikasi yang akan dilakukan.
Konstan Heksadesimal Desimal Arti msidbIniFileActionRemoveLine 0x002 2 Menghapus entri .ini. msidbIniFileActionRemoveTag 0x004 4 Menghapus tag dari entri .ini. -
Component_
-
Kunci eksternal ke dalam kolom pertama tabel Komponen mereferensikan komponen yang mengontrol penghapusan nilai .ini.
Komentar
Informasi file .ini dihapus ketika Komponen yang sesuai telah dipilih untuk diinstal, baik secara lokal atau dijalankan dari sumber.
Tabel ini disebut ketika tindakan RemoveIniValues dijalankan.
Jika kolom Directory_ ditentukan sebagai null, lokasi file ini adalah lokasi ini Windows standar yang merupakan direktori Windows secara default.
Menghapus nilai terakhir dari bagian akan menghapus bagian tersebut. Tidak ada cara lain untuk menghapus seluruh bagian selain menghapus semua nilainya.
Validasi
ICE03
ICE06
ICE32
ICE40
ICE46
ICE69